Providing quality food sources for your wildlife throughout the summer is critical if you want to maximize the wildlife on your property.
Summer is a stressful period for wildlife in the Southeast, which is why we worked with Pennington Seed Company to develop custom food plot seed blends that grow well here,”said Dave Edwards, wildlife biologist with Westervelt Wildlife Services.

In addition to the heat, many biological processes take place in the summer such as fawning, milk production in does, bucks growing antlers, and young quail and turkeys growing. When planted, these seed blends provide much-needed nutrition for wildlife. Providing a quality food source for wildlife during the stressful summer is one of the best ways to improve your fall hunting, he said.
